Best Time to Visit Seychelles
Seychelles also has local festivals all year round. These festivals show off the islands’ rich culture and traditions. You can find more information in a Seychelles travel guide8.
The Praslin Culinary & Arts Festival in September and the Ocean Festival in October are notable events. They promote local culture and conservation efforts8.
Here are some key events and conditions to consider when planning your trip:
- April: One of the hottest months, popular for Seychelles island resorts, featuring excellent diving and snorkelling conditions6.
- May: Slightly less humidity compared to April, as the southeast trade wind begins6.
- September: Little rain and slightly warmer temperatures, ideal for sunbathing and swimming6.
- October: Pleasant weather as the transition period between southeast and northwest trade winds occurs6.

Top Islands to Explore
Planning a trip to Seychelles? Knowing the top islands to visit is key. Seychelles boasts 115 islands9, each with its own charm. The travel guide suggests Mahé, Praslin, and La Digue for an unforgettable journey.
Here’s a table to help with island-hopping:
Island | Distance from Mahé | Travel Time |
---|---|---|
Praslin | 44 km | 1 hour by ferry |
La Digue | 52 km | 1.5 hours by ferry |

Getting Around Seychelles
Here’s a quick look at your travel choices:
- Inter-island ferry services
- Car rentals
- Taxis
By looking at these options, you can plan your Seychelles trip easily. Seychelles is perfect for any traveler, with its stunning islands and easy ways to get around20.
Transportation Option | Cost | Duration |
---|---|---|
Inter-island ferry | $16-$87 | 1-90 minutes |
Car rental | $60 per day | Varies |
Taxi | $2 per kilometer | Varies |

Sustainable Tourism in Seychelles
Seychelles is all about sustainable tourism. They work hard to protect nature and help local communities23. They’ve set up marine protected areas and eco-tourism projects to boost seychelles tourism and the local economy24. Visitors can help by staying in eco-friendly places and respecting local ways25.
They’ve made 50% of Seychelles’ land nature reserves25. They also have marine national parks to save marine life23. Many resorts and hotels are hiring locals and helping community projects23. What are the top islands to explore in Seychelles?
Seychelles is an archipelago of 115 islands, each unique. Mahé is the largest island, with diverse beaches, forests, and mountains. Praslin is famous for the Vallée de Mai nature reserve,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. La Digue is known for its breathtaking scenery, perfect for nature lovers and photographers.

What are some of the must-see attractions in Seychelles?
Seychelles is home to stunning attractions, including Anse Source d’Argent, Morne Seychellois National Park, and Curieuse Island. Anse Source d’Argent is one of the most beautiful beaches in the world. Morne Seychellois National Park is a UNESCO World Heritage Site with lush forests and diverse wildlife. Curieuse Island is home to a large population of giant tortoises, offering a unique opportunity to see these amazing creatures up close.
